Outlast Download Free for PC

Outlast Download free isn't always genuinely a game of skill, and as it turns out, that makes experience. No longer…

F1 2017 Download Free PC

There are approaches to take a look at annualised certified releases like F1 2017 Download free. One is to examine…

The Sims 5 Download Free PC

The Sims 5 Download Free PC may be very a great deal going on breaking new floor for EA's liked franchise. The…

Humanity Download Free Full PC

You're forgiven in case you've forgotten approximately Humanity Download Free Full PC, the sport from Rez creator…